Mechanical vapor recompression (MVR) is an energy-saving evaporation and crystallization process for saline wastewater treatments; however, its proper application depends on many conditions. We performed evaporation experiments on 57 wastewater samples, with ten parameters generated for each sample, then performed decision tree models to determine if the samples were directly suitable for mechanical vapor recompression. Our results indicated that the decision tree analysis successfully classified our samples, and exergy analysis demonstrated MVR had great energy saving potential.
